2.
What time _____ to school this morning?
Correct Answer
B. Did she get
Explanation
The correct answer is "did she get". This is because the question is asking about the time in the past when someone went to school. In English, when forming a question in the past tense, we use the auxiliary verb "did" followed by the subject and the base form of the main verb. Therefore, "did she get" is the correct structure for asking about the time she went to school this morning.

7.
_____ away last weekend?
Correct Answer
A. Did you go
Explanation
The correct answer is "Did you go." This is the correct form of the question in the past tense. "Did you went" is grammatically incorrect as "did" is already the past tense form of the verb "do," so another past tense verb is not needed. "Went you" is also incorrect as the subject "you" should come before the verb "went" in a question.

15.
What time _____ the film start?
Correct Answer
A. Does
Explanation
The question is asking for the correct auxiliary verb to use with the subject "the film" in order to form a question about the time. In this case, the correct auxiliary verb is "does." This is because when forming a question in the present simple tense with a third person singular subject, we use "does" + the base form of the main verb. Therefore, the correct question formation would be "What time does the film start?"
